ENGENHARIA DE SOFTWARE 2
O que é Produto de Software? Produto de Software é o conjunto de programas de computador, procedimentos, documentação e dados associados que compõe o software.
O que é Processo de Software ? É um conjunto de tarefas requeridas para construir um software de qualidade.
Processos x Produto O processo utilizado no desenvolvimento de um projetotem grande reflexo na produtividade e na qualidade do software desenvolvido. Os estudos sobre qualidade, mais recentemente, são voltados para o melhoramento do processo de desenvolvimento de software, pois ao garantir a qualidade do processo, já se está dando um grande passo para garantir também a qualidade do produto.
Definições de Qualidade
Existem diversas definições para o que vem a ser qualidade algumas das mais importantes são:
• Termo subjetivo com significados diferentes para pessoas e contextos diferentes.
•
• Conjunto de Propriedades de um produto ou serviço, que lhe oferecem aptidões para satisfazer as necessidades explicitas ou implícitas (ISO 8402, 1994)
•
• Grau com que o conjunto de propriedades inerentes ao produto satisfaz os requisitos. ( ISO 2000 )
Qualidade de Produto A qualidade do produto de software deverá garantir algumas características para que esse seja considerado realmente um produto de qualidade. Essas características são :
Normas que definem a Qualidade do Produto de Software • ISO 9126 – Define as características da qualidade do Produto de Software.
• NBR 13596 - Versão Brasileira da ISSO 9126
•ISO 1498 – Guia para a avaliação do Produto de Software baseado nas práticas apresentadas na ISO 9126.
• ISO 12119 - Características de qualidade de pacotes de software.
• IEEE P1061 – Metodologias para Medir Qualidade de Produto de Software. Qualidade de Processo A qualidade de processo é garantir que as tarefas que envolve o passo a passo de como desenvolver um bom software